in a right triangle, a and b are the lengths of the legs and c is the length of the hypotenuse. if b = 6.2 miles and c = 8.6 miles, what is a? if necessary, round to the nearest tenth.
a = miles

Explanation:

Step1: Apply Pythagorean theorem

In a right - triangle, $a^{2}+b^{2}=c^{2}$, so $a=\sqrt{c^{2}-b^{2}}$.

Step2: Substitute given values

Substitute $b = 6.2$ and $c = 8.6$ into the formula: $a=\sqrt{8.6^{2}-6.2^{2}}=\sqrt{(8.6 + 6.2)(8.6 - 6.2)}$ (using $x^{2}-y^{2}=(x + y)(x - y)$). First, calculate $8.6+6.2 = 14.8$ and $8.6 - 6.2=2.4$. Then $a=\sqrt{14.8\times2.4}=\sqrt{35.52}$.

Step3: Calculate the square - root and round

$\sqrt{35.52}\approx5.96\approx6.0$.

Answer:

$6.0$
